What the 5 star energy rating means for your dryer
A 5 star energy rating communicates a high level of efficiency in the appliance itself. It reflects how effectively the dryer converts electrical energy into heat and how well the unit uses that heat to remove moisture from clothes. The rating is determined by standardized testing protocols that compare energy use across models under typical household loads. While the core idea is simple, real-world results depend on installation quality, venting condition, and usage patterns. Venting and installation: the invisible efficiency factor
The ductwork, vent length, and straightness of the run have a significant impact on dryer efficiency. A long, irregular vent can trap heat, increase dryer cycling, and waste energy. Use smooth-walled metal ducting where possible, minimize twists, and keep vent paths as short as feasible. A properly sealed installation with a clean vent also reduces the risk of fire hazards and improves overall performance. The rating assumes that venting is optimized, so plan for proper installation from day one to maximize gains.
Maintenance habits that protect performance
Maintenance is a silent multiplier for efficiency. Regularly clean the lint trap, inspect the vent for lint accumulation, and check seals around the door and cabinet for leaks. Dust and lint buildup can drive longer dry times and higher energy use. A quarterly or semiannual vent cleaning schedule helps maintain peak performance. Calculating ROI: a simple example
ROI can be estimated with a straightforward formula: ROI = (annual savings) / (upfront premium). If a 5-star model costs $250 more than a standard unit but saves $60 per year in energy costs, the payback is roughly 4–5 years, assuming stable electricity prices. Real-world ROI will vary with local rates and household usage. Use conservative estimates and track energy bills for accuracy.
